A Divvy alternative that works with the cards you already have

Divvy, now part of BILL Spend and Expense, pairs free spend-management software with corporate cards and budgets. It is a genuinely useful package for teams that want budgeting and expense tracking bundled with cards at no software cost, and the budget-first controls work well for many companies. The consideration buyers raise when weighing Divvy alternatives is the same one that applies to card-led platforms: getting the full benefit means adopting Divvy's cards and credit line rather than keeping their current banking.

Expenditure is software-first and built to run on the cards and banks you already have. It reads receipts, categorizes to the right GL account, enforces policy, and gives a real-time view of every dollar across cards, vendors and subscriptions, with proactive flags for duplicate tools, unused seats and price creep. You get modern AI categorization, real-time visibility and savings insight on transparent per-seat pricing, with no card switch.

Side by side

Divvy vs Expenditure, honestly

A fair look at what each does well. Both are capable tools. Here is where they differ.

What matters Expenditure Divvy
Works with your existing cards and banks Runs on the Visa and Mastercard cards and banks you already have, no switch required Built around Divvy corporate cards and credit line
Receipt OCR and AI categorization Reads vendor, amount, date, tax and line items, then categorizes to the right GL account Receipt capture and expense coding
Real-time spend visibility Live view of every dollar across cards, vendors and subscriptions Budget-first spend tracking across Divvy cards
Waste and savings insight Proactively flags duplicate subscriptions, unused tools and price creep Budgets and spend controls
Policy enforcement and approvals Checks each transaction against policy and routes approvals automatically Budget limits and approval workflows
Pricing Transparent per-seat pricing you can see upfront Free software paired with corporate cards

Comparison reflects general, publicly understood positioning. Capabilities change, so check each product for the latest.
